What is the average MOT pass rate for a Mini Mini Cooper S Auto?

The Mini Mini Cooper S Auto has an average 75.7% MOT pass rate across model years 2005 to 2007, based on DVSA test data.

What are the most common MOT failures on a Mini Mini Cooper S Auto?

The most common MOT failure reasons for the Mini Mini Cooper S Auto across all years are: a tyre seriously damaged, brake disc or drum excessively weakened, insecure or fractured, fluid leaking excessively and likely to harm the environment or to pose a safety risk to other road users. These are typical wear items that can often be checked and addressed before your test.
